The Digital Revolution in Western Oklahoma
Residents and businesses in Burns Flat and Granite, Oklahoma, are celebrating a significant technological leap as high-speed fiber internet goes live in their communities. This rollout marks a transformative moment for connectivity in western Oklahoma, highlighting the commitment to expand broadband access in rural areas. With funding from the federal State and Local Fiscal Recovery Fund, the initiative aims to empower local households by providing the infrastructure needed to thrive in an increasingly digital world.
What This Means for Local Residents
For families and businesses alike, access to reliable internet is no longer a luxury but a necessity. The new fiber optic service, provided by Dobson Fiber, delivers enhanced connectivity to 366 locations, enabling opportunities for educational enhancement, telehealth services, and business operations. The high-speed capabilities—up to 10 gigabits per second—are not just numbers; they represent the potential for economic growth and improved quality of life in these communities.
Broader Implications for Connectivity
As Mike Sanders, Executive Director of the Oklahoma Broadband Office, stated, this expansion reflects a larger strategy to ensure that 95 percent of Oklahomans have access to high-speed internet. This goal aligns with the state’s commitment to bridging the digital divide, ensuring that both urban and rural residents can participate fully in today’s digital economy, whether that be for education, remote work, or starting a small business.
Continuing Expansion Efforts
The completion of these projects illustrates the effectiveness of public investment in broadband infrastructure. With an ambitious plan set by the Oklahoma Legislature allocating $374 million for broadband initiatives, there are currently 159 projects statewide—more than 75% are either in construction or nearing completion. This momentum bodes well for future expansions and improvements in connectivity across the region.
What’s Next for Burns Flat and Granite
As fiber internet becomes more prevalent, residents in Burns Flat and Granite can check service availability using the Oklahoma Broadband Dashboard. Community members are encouraged to stay informed about new developments. Dobson Fiber’s vision extends beyond just providing internet; they aim to revolutionize connectivity, helping to ensure that these localities can participate economically and socially at a level comparable to larger urban centers.
